  • Episode 3 of this 4 part series.
    This 4 part series, narrated by James Nesbitt, takes to the skies with unprecedented access to one of the world’s most famous airlines and a great British brand. In BA’s centenary year, our cameras have been given exclusive access to all areas of the business from the boardroom to the boarding gate.
